LEO 1430 Essential Specifications
3.5nm resolution @ 30kV (tungsten), 2.5nm @ 30kV (LaB6)
Tungsten or optional LaB6 firing unit
200V to 30kV accelerating voltage with automatic EHT bias
Unique Optibeam column control algorithm
Magnification range 15X to 300kX
Choice of solid state or scintillator back scattered detectors
LEO 1430 Essential Specifications
3 built in ‘real time’ image processing modes
3072 x 2304 pixel image store with square pixels
Extensive annotation and measurement facilities
5 axis motorised high precision geared stage in extra large chamber
LEO 32 and WindowsTM 98 or optional NT4.0 operating system
